Key Differences

The Warm Company (A) is natural cotton batting in a queen size and is noted for value and ease of use, while MISSOURI STAR (B) is an 80/60 cotton-poly blend in full size that advertises low shrinkage (3–5%) and easier cutting/sewing but is reported by several customers as thinner. Pick A if you want natural cotton, a queen-size option, and higher review volume; pick B if you prefer a cotton/poly blend with lower shrinkage and easier handling when cutting and sewing

MISSOURI STAR QUILT CO. • ★ 4.1/5 • Budget

Premium quilting batting 80% cotton, 20% polyester with low loft for warm, soft quilts. Easily stitched up to 8 inches apart; suitable for hand or machine quilting. Customer note: soft, warm, easy to sew with minimal lint

Pros

  • 80/20 cotton-poly blend
  • low shrinkage 3-5%
  • stitching up to 8 inches apart
  • soft and easy to work with

Cons

  • mixed feedback on thickness
